Wed 24 Aug 2005 07:13:09 PM UTC, comment #3: 

On mingw, off_t is long.  This causes files > 2 gig to fail in os_lseek. 

This updated patch uses off64_t for mingw.

Tested mld 2.6.3 on linux/cygwin/mingw, with 2 and 4.5 gig files.

Wed 24 Aug 2005 05:16:49 AM UTC, comment #2: 

I receive:

Fatal error: exception Unix.Unix_error(12, "os_read", "")

when trying to ed2k_hash 2+ gig files at the bitprint part (sha1 and tigertree).  I also think that I noticed an infinite loop in tiger_block_size when the int is overflowed.

This is obviously all due to the use of ints. 

Attached is a patch I used to switch to size_t and tested on small files, 2 gig files, and 4.5 gig files. All seem to work for me now.  Tested on linux and cygwin (haven't tried mingw) with mld 2.6.3.
 
The hash results still match bitzi bitcollider and ed2k-tools.sf.net's ed2khash app, but both of those apps fail on files > 2 gigs.  I don't know of another app with which to compare.
